Welcome to the August Link-a-thon! You’ve probably heard that the Dallas Stars have announced this year’s inductees to the Stars Hall of Fame. Brenden Morrow and Jim Lites are different guys with one big thing in common: They’re do their best work when the going gets tough, writes Mike Heika:

Lites, the original team president when the Stars moved to Dallas, has navigated his share of crises in three different stints with the team. Morrow, meanwhile, overcame injuries and challenges to finish sixth all-time in franchise history in games played at 825. Both are a huge part of the winning history of the Stars and will be honored as the newest nominees in the categories of Builder and Player.

“You couldn’t really pick two better guys,” said Stars analyst Daryl Reaugh. “I think they both represent what this organization stands for.”

While Stars President and CEO Brad Alberts added, “Brenden and Jim are both extremely deserving of this honor. Their fingerprints are all over this organization and will be for a long time.”

  • That other North Texas franchise, the Allen Americans, is joining forces with Utah Hockey Club (To Be Named Later) as its ECHL affiliate. [Dallas Morning News]
  • Dan Bylsma has been promoted to Seattle Kraken head coach, and former Texas Stars bench boss Derek Laxdal is taking his old job with their AHL affiliate. [The AHL]
